Summary:
The Education Manager acts as an ambassador of the Zoo through a variety of on-site and off-site educational programs. Duties include designing and leading curriculum-based programs, participating in offsite outreaches, supporting daily education and interpretive programs, engaging with guests, and overseeing Zoo Educators. This position works cooperatively with the Education Department, Zoo team members, volunteers, and interns to ensure exceptional guest service while upholding Zoo policies.
This Manager position will oversee the Guest Engagement and School & Public Programs portfolios, encompassing onsite, offsite, and virtual experiences for a variety of audiences. Additionally, this role collaborates with community partners to develop customized programs, workshops, and educator kits that support the Zoo’s mission. All Managers contribute to our seasonal events, as well as any education programming as needed.

Work Environment:
While performing the duties of the job, the employee will frequently work in alternate settings between indoors (classroom/office environment) and outdoors (Zoo grounds). When outdoors this position is required to work in various weather conditions including rain, humidity, and extreme heat or cold. This position has extensive interaction with large groups of children and adults.
